My grandfather passed away recently and I was one of three beneficiaries. When I called to confirm my information, I was told that the benefits would be expedited for payment to me through a lump sum check.

After going through all of their information gathering, I hung up, satisfied that the payment would be made.

Two days later, I get a call from Prudential telling me that it can't be expedited and I have to jump through all sorts of hoops and fill out a huge claims form, mail it in with a death certificate, and then wait 5-7 business days.

I asked why it can't be expedited and got no answer so I called back and got someone else. They asked for a policy number which I didn't have handy and asked for them to just look it up by my grandfather's name. They didn't have that ability - they are the only company on the planet who can't look up by name.

This morning, I called again with the policy number and got transferred. That person told me that it can't be expedited, which I already knew. I asked why, and she read from a script telling me that it can't be expedited and would be processed in 5-7 days, etc. I explained again that I knew that, and wanted to know why it couldn't be expedited. She said she can't tell me because of proprietary reasons.

In other words, jump through these hoops because we said so and we don't have to give any reasons why we do what we do.

I would never do business with this company. Considering that I'm in a career that deals with life insurance companies often, I'll be telling my clients to avoid them in the future.
